🚨 ICBA OPPOSES CLARITY ACT OVER STABLECOIN “LOOPHOLE” The Independent Community Bankers of America (ICBA) is pushing back against the Digital Asset Market CLARITY Act, arguing that its current stablecoin provisions could leave a loophole for crypto companies to offer interest-like rewards or yield on payment stablecoins. 🏦 Why are banks concerned? ICBA says yield-bearing stablecoins could compete directly with traditional bank deposits. Their argument: ➡️ Depositors could move money from banks into stablecoins ➡️ Banks could lose deposits used to fund loans ➡️ Small businesses, farmers and homebuyers could face reduced access to credit ➡️ Crypto intermediaries could gain an advantage without the same banking infrastructure ICBA estimates that a large-scale shift could mean $1.3 trillion in lost community-bank deposits and potentially $850 billion less in community-bank lending. ⚖️ ICBA’s demand The banking group isn't opposing digital-asset regulation altogether. It wants the CLARITY Act to strengthen the prohibition on interest-like payments and rewards for holding payment stablecoins, arguing that stablecoins should not become substitutes for traditional bank deposits. 🔥 The bigger battle: Crypto companies want innovation and competitive digital payments. Banks want to prevent stablecoins from pulling deposits out of the banking system. The Senate is now facing a major policy question: Should stablecoins be allowed to compete with bank deposits for yield — or should that door be completely closed? #DigitalAssets #bitcoin #USDC #USDT #ICBAOpposesCLARITYActOverStablecoinLoophole
